Steps to Getting Your License

Use this guide to make sure you are in the right place in your licensing journey.
1

Pass Drivers Ed Course

Before you can take your written test at the DMV, you must pass a state-approved Drivers Ed course and receive your completion certificate.

Start Course
2

Practice for Written Test

Once you have your completion certificate, it is time to practice! Take our practice test questions to ace your exam on the first try!

3

Pass Written Test at DMV

Ready to go? Make a reservation at the DMV and go pass your test! Once you pass, you will receive your permit.

4

Take Driving Lessons

Passed your test? Great! Now you are ready to take your first driving lessons. Reserve your spot now so you can get going as soon as you have your permit.

5

Pass your Road Test

After completing your driving lessons, you can take your road test. Make a reservation at the DMV and go pass your test to receive your license.

Driving lessons in Occidental offer a unique and peaceful start to your journey behind the wheel. The area is known for its quiet, winding country roads through redwood forests, creating an ideal environment for learning fundamentals like vehicle control without the pressure of heavy traffic. Mastering these basics in a calm setting builds a strong foundation.

Once comfortable, lessons expand to the varied conditions found throughout Sonoma County. You will gain experience navigating busier roads toward nearby towns like Sebastopol and Santa Rosa. This progression provides practical skills on more active state routes, preparing you for a wide range of real-world traffic scenarios and intersection types.
